WebThe Smart Toe II intramedullary implant was designed for correction of a hammertoe deformity. It offers rotational stability and compression across the joint line, while avoiding potential complications experienced with k-wires, such as pin tract infection and post-operative exposure. WebFeb 12, 2024 · DynaNite ® PIP Hammertoe Implant DynaNite® PIP Hammertoe Implant The DynaNite PIP hammertoe implant is a threaded, cannulated, nitinol solution for hammer toe deformities. The implant barbs are extended by inserting a K-wire and maintain fixation due to the material properties of nitinol.

WebAug 26, 2024 · A hammertoe is a deformity in which the proximal inter-phalangeal joint (IPJ) is flexed. A claw toe is a deformity of the toe in which the meta-tarso-phalangeal (MTP) joint is pulled up or extended.
